Aug 2013 Report for the jUDDI project

jUDDI (pronounced "Judy") is an open source Java implementation of the Universal Description, Discovery, and Integration (UDDI v3) specification for (Web) Services. The jUDDI project includes Scout. Scout is an implementation of the JSR 93 - Java API for XML Registries 1.0 (JAXR).

*jUDDI *
- We released version 3.1.5 adding a much improved distribution with quickstart examples, a way to create deployments using different JPA or JAXWS implementations for different target platforms, lots of fixes of bugs found by the work that is taking place on the console.
- Very low traffic on the mailing lists this quarter.
- Working on the 3.2 release which includes a full web based console.
- We deployed a jUDDI instance to the OpenShift Cloud, to make it easy for people to try it out.
http://apachejuddi.blogspot.com/2013/08/uddi-in-openshift-cloud.html

*Scout *
- No release this period, not really any development took place.
- Very low volume of JAXR related questions on the mailing list.
